The Importance of Badges in NBA 2K23
NBA 2K23 is a basketball simulation video game that allows players to create and customize their own player to join the NBA. The game features a badge system that enhances a player's skills and abilities, giving them a better chance to succeed on the court. These badges are divided into four categories: Finishing, Shooting, Playmaking, and Defense/Rebounding.
Introducing the Core Badge Requirements
In NBA 2K23, there are certain requirements for players to earn the coveted Core Badges. These badges are essential in improving a player's overall performance on the court. Here are the Core Badge requirements:
| Badge Name | Category | Requirement |
|---|---|---|
| Contact Finisher | Finishing | Score 75 contact layups/dunks |
| Deep Threes | Shooting | Make 50 shots from 5 feet beyond the 3-point line |
| Dimer | Playmaking | Get 150 assists within a single season |
| Clamps | Defense/Rebounding | Get 35 stops while playing as a perimeter defender |
How to Maximize Your Badge Progression
Earning badges can be a challenging task, but there are ways to maximize your progression. Here are some tips:
Focus on Your Badge Category
Choose a primary and secondary badge category and focus on improving the related skills. For example, if you want to earn the Deep Threes badge, focus on improving your shooting from beyond the 3-point line.
Try Different Game Modes
Playing different game modes such as MyCAREER, MyTEAM, and Park can help you earn badges faster. Each mode has its own specific challenges and requirements for earning badges.
Utilize Training Drills and Workouts
The game offers various training drills and workouts that can help you improve specific skills, allowing you to earn badges faster. Make sure to use them frequently.
